L2 System Administrator

Job Description

Provide comprehensive L1/L2 technical support for a premier client

Maintain enterprise infrastructure across Windows and Linux environments

Manage Windows Server 2016/2019/2022 and Active Directory

Perform Linux system administration, shell scripting, and system maintenance

Troubleshoot and maintain server hardware

Troubleshoot networks, including TCP/IP, DNS, DHCP, and VLAN configuration

Support VMware vSphere and Hyper‑V virtualization platforms

Perform backup and recovery operations

Manage patches and monitor security compliance

Monitor performance and optimize systems

Resolve and expand ITSM tickets

Provide advanced workstation software break‑fix support for Windows and Linux clients

Perform IMAC operations in enterprise environments

Image and deploy systems using SCCM, WDS, or similar tools

Manage asset lifecycle and inventory control

Support enterprise printers and peripherals, including network printers

Provide Client Center/Tech Bar technical support

Diagnose and replace hardware

Troubleshoot network connectivity and manage cabling

Provide regular onsite support in Tempe, Arizona twice weekly, with additional remote support responsibilities

Work occasional maintenance windows during evenings or weekends
